Bluemix a récemment ajouté un support pour les conteneurs docker. Le nouveau service conteneur nous permet de créer des conteneurs à partir de la bibliothèque d'images Docker pré-configurées, appelée Docker Hub. Ces conteneurs sont légers, rapides et très polyvalents. L'une des premières questions que les développeurs se posent quand ils commencent à travailler avec des conteneurs est : comment puis-je lier les services du catalogue Bluemix à mon conteneur ?
Actuellement, Bluemix prend en charge les applications de liaison aux conteneurs. La liaison d'une application au conteneur prendra la variable d'environnement VCAP_SERVICES de l'application choisie et l'annexera aux variables d'environnement du conteneur. La variable VCAP_SERVICES est une chaîne de caractères JSON contenant toutes les informations d'identification pour les services et les API liées à une application. Ce processus d'ajout permet au conteneur d'analyser ces données et d'accéder à tous les services liés à l'application.
Partager